quotingSo the Houthis fire a lot of drones at ships in the Red Sea. The Americans and Brits shoot down virtually every single one of them. I thought obviously the Houthis aren't very capable, and America and the UK are very capable, and the Houthis probably need to come up with another tactic.

But then I learned that Houthi drones cost $2,000 while the American missiles that shoot them down cost $2,100,000. So even when the drones don't hit anything, the Houthis achieve something of great worth: wasting an expensive American missile.
